Well I was introduced to Bukowski by one of my friends about six months back and since then life hasn't been the same. Charles bukowski is an author who is able to reach deep inside your soul. It is not because Bukowski's works are very complex or mind boggling but due to the ease with which he conveys simple feelings and emotions stored in everyone's heart. Bukowski's work consists of an ordinary man's everyday thoughts and feelings but his greatness lies in the ease with which he puts these feelings into words. It all started with a few of Bukowski's quotations and since then he hasn't left my head. A brutally honest writer and a true great.In "Ham on Rye" Bukowski narrates the incidents of his acne ridden childhood and the difference of opinion with his father and it can be seen how his childhood shaped his life and his literary career. A must read. I'd suggest you people to also read some of his other works such as "Post Office" and "Women".
